"Get Over It"

"Get Over It"
So by now everyone has had a chance to take a peek at Barack Obama's commentary that distaste for John McCain should help women disenchanted with his nomination to just "get over it."

I've said before that I never pegged Barack Obama as a sexist.  But what with this, the "sweetie" thing and his cavalier assurance that "you're likable enough, Hillary" -- well, it's hard not wonder whether he's a little tone deaf when it comes to dealing with females.
